Several crucial measures must be followed to localize software. The first step is to gather all strings of text from the codebase and put them into one place. The next step is to convert each line into the required language. Finally, the translated strings must be included in the program by recompiling. However, if you want your program to be used by people worldwide, you’ll need to go through the trouble and effort of localizing it.
Advice on Software Internationalization and Localization
Since much guidance is available, it might not be easy to know where to begin when researching software internationalization and localization. As you start this procedure, keep these guidelines in mind.
- Learn from what others have experienced; a wealth of resources detailing the best methods for internationalizing and localizing software. Before making any choices, ensure you’ve read up on the subject and are comfortable with the numerous techniques.
- Preparation is vital since internationalization and localization are processes that may be difficult and time-consuming if not well planned.
- Hiring professionals with experience and knowledge in the sector of software localization services is a good idea when working on something as crucial as software internationalization and translation. Doing so will aid in producing a superior product.
- There will inevitably be obstacles, so it’s best to be ready for them when they arise. Try to maintain a cheerful disposition and a sense of humor by being patient and adaptable in facing adversity.
In What Way Does Localization Help?
Localization refers to tailoring a service or product to a particular geographic area and bringing a regional flavor or aesthetic to international development.
Businesses may learn more about their target audiences and provide better service through localization. Profit margins may be boosted by cutting wasteful spending and improving productivity with its help.
Localization has several advantages, including those listed below:
- Sales growth: expanding your consumer base in your target market via product or service localization. A higher market share and more sales are possible outcomes.
- As a result of your increased familiarity with the requirements of your target market, you will be able to provide superior service to your clientele. The result may be more content and devoted customers.
- Advantages in terms of saving time and money may be gained by localization. This has the potential to boost productivity and earnings.
- Enhanced ability to compete more profoundly to a more profound familiarity with the market and your competition gained via localization. A better competitive position and larger market share may result from this.
- Brand reputation and recognition may be strengthened via localization. This can potentially increase brand recognition and devotion.
Price Of Localization
To localize is to adopt a service or product to the specific needs of a region and to make a product or service more approachable and attractive to a particular demographic. Localization often considers the local language, culture, and traditions.
Indeed, localization isn’t always cheap, but it may be well worth the expense. When a product or service is made more readily available to a local market, it may help the company access previously unreachable income streams and expand into previously untapped markets.
Awareness and devotion to a brand may be expanded via localization as well. This can increase the company’s success via recurring customers and word-of-mouth advertising. Businesses may forge closer bonds with their clientele by focusing on the needs of their immediate geographic area.
In summary, localization may be an expensive but rewarding investment for companies seeking to expand into new areas and build their brand. A company’s ability to expand into new markets and attract customers requires understanding the local language, culture, and traditions.
How Often Should You Localize Your Software?
Putting a software product into a localized context, implementing country-specific features, or adapting the user interface to local traditions fall under this category, as does translate the user interface, helping files, and information into the local language.
To what extent you must localize your program regularly depends on several factors, and there is no universally accepted solution. The pace of change in the potential customers, the nature of your software product, and your company objectives are all elements that will determine how often you need to update your localization.
Regular localization updates will be required if your software product targets a dynamic market. If you’re making a mobile app for a region where OS updates often happen, like the United States, you’ll need to keep it compatible with the latest OS version as soon as it comes out.
On the other hand, you may get away with fewer regular updates to your translation if your software product is not prone to such quick changes. If your desktop program isn’t updated much, localization could be unnecessary more often than once per several years.
The Program Has To Be Localized
The application must be localized. This procedure aims to make the software suitable for localization into other tongues and cultural contexts. Keep in mind that localization is not the same thing as translation. The only thing that gets changed when you translate an app is the text. However, localization alters the software to fit the target audience’s needs, which is why a software localization company will function well.
There are several compelling arguments in favor of localizing software. For starters, it broadens the program’s potential user base. In addition, it aids in making the software more user-friendly. To do this, not only is the text localized, but the UI and any visuals as well, so that they are appropriate for the target culture.
Third, localization may improve the effectiveness of the program. Fourth, localization may boost the program’s quality. The process of localization is intricate. To guarantee that the application is translated correctly, it is recommended that you use a competent localization firm.
While the localization process may be challenging and time-consuming, it is essential if you want your product to be utilized worldwide. Important considerations for localizing software include:
- Investigating the market.
- Learning the local language and customs.
- Using a competent translation firm to assure correctness.
If you follow these guidelines, your software will be helpful and available all across the globe.